Danfoss PVG Proportional Multi way Valve:
PVG32 load sensitive proportional valve: The load sensitive proportional valve includes two series. PVG32 and PVG120 can be assembled separately or in combination.
PVG120 load sensitive proportional valve: Similar to PVG32, PVG120 is also a load sensitive combination directional valve. Its modular structure makes it possible for one valve group to control all actions of the machine.
Danfoss PVG Proportional Multi way ValveModular design, flexible system configuration, adopting mature and reliable PVE proportional control technology, simplifying system installation and setting using load sensitive technology, improving system efficiency and reducing power consumption, flow is not affected by load changes, making operation more accurate. The SIL 2 certified digital driver (PVED-CX) is used.

The electrical driver
We offer a range of electrical drivers, from simple ON/OFF control to CAN bus communication control. Our PVED-CC and PVED-CX digital drivers are specifically designed for the J1939/ISOBUS protocol and CANopen system. PVED-CX has also undergone SIL 2 certification (SIL2 complies with IEC 61508 requirements), meeting the requirements of the European Machinery Directive 2006/42/EC, which can further reduce the time and cost associated with system certification and vehicle certification.
